After two devastating predator losses, I am rethinking everything. I only keep two girls, the loss of one was tough. I replaced each one, so still have two.
I am setting up a new run which will hold the coop. Eventually they are going to have their own little Hobbitown. They will have a round door, a nice, well, true to the movies, a not so perfect, uneven fence. I may even cut some of the smaller trees on the outskirt of my property and make a wooden fence. It will be located between a 6' privacy fence on one side and the solarium side of the house on the other. Dimensions, 16x32, or maybe 40, if I feel like it. I would like to grow something tall on the West side for shade that will still allow some air through. South MS is HOT most of the year. I live on the Gulf Coast.
I am researching ideas for fun things to put into their town. For sure there will be a nice dirt bath, a couple of automatic waterers, and plenty of shade from the trees.
I'm not sure what to do about cover because there are three trees. About half can be covered, what about the rest? Could I string something like barbed wire over the remaining top? It would let the leaves and pine straw through. There will be a natural bed of pine straw.
I digress...I want to start some forage flats for them. There is little grass and it will be gone soon. My thoughts were to start about six good sized, mobile, flats. I would like to fill them with worms, and, chicken forage. By keeping it going and starting one every other week, I can provide them with fresh greens and worms. Has anyone done this? Any ideas?
I am not wealthy; I do not have any bad habits; my girls are my bad habit. I have a couple of acres, I can set up a winter flat and grow in my huge solarium. I just want them to be safe and happy.
